After the internal components for a single gearbox, the FIA is accelerating on the file of the standardization of certain parts in F1.
Latest areas concerned: brakes and rims with two calls for tenders launched by the international federation a few days ago. In terms of brakes, pads, discs, calipers, master cylinder and the famous brake-by-wire system are targeted. The rims must, for their part, move to 18″ format, with 60 sets supplied per season, and a lifespan of more than 10 km.
The period desired by the FIA should run between 2021 and 2024, with the possibility of adding the 2025 campaign to the contract. Interested candidates must submit their applications before May 22, with the FIA decision expected on June 14.
